How many ofshore wind energy patents are there?
This study identifies approximately 17 000 patent families related to ofshore wind energy technologies published between and , as well as revealing a significant surge from onwards. European countries, particularly Denmark and Germany, have taken the lead in generating inventions.
Which ofshore wind industry has the most patents?
Floating foundations, transportation, and mechanical transmission accounted for the largest number of patents within the ofshore wind area. Some key policy insights from the patent data are summarised below: Increased invention in ofshore wind with dominance in Europa, Asia and USA emerging as future market.
